WebApr 18, 2016 · The table reports the number of observations that have a common pattern of missing values. In addition to counts, the table reports mean values for each group. Because the table is very wide, I have truncated some of the mean values. The first row counts the number of complete observation. There are 5039 observations that have no missing values.

WebApr 16, 2024 · Interpretation of a set of oblique factors involves both the pattern and structure matrices, as well as the factor correlation matrix. The latter matrix contains the correlations among all pairs of factors in the solution. It is automatically printed for an oblique solution when the rotated factor matrix is printed.
